jQuery的validate插件使用整理(第三部分:扩展)

2019-03-19 00:00|来源: 领悟书生

1. 自定义验证规则

除了内置的验证规则,validation还允许自定义验证规则。这是通过validation的addMethod()方法实现的,语法 为:

jQuery.validator.addMethod("name",function,message)

其中:

1,name为验证规则的名称

2,function定义验证的规则。参数有?。返回值为?。

3,message是验证失败时的提示信息。

2. 让错误提示信息显示到指定的位置

$(function(){

   $("form").validate({wrapper:'div'});

});

3.   对于radiocheckbox等的验证指定


本文链接:jQuery的validate插件使用整理(第三部分:扩展),http://www.656463.com/article/564

相关问答

更多

爱情公寓第三部陆展博拿出桌游的时候放的那个奏乐是什么

裂变大地主题曲 魔兽世界大地的裂变 游戏 主音乐,也是登陆音乐。 The Shattering

暮光之城 ;第三部 《月食》(Eclipse) 是何时在哪里开拍的 , 何时将会上映, ?

温哥华拍摄 《暮光之城3:月食》在2010年6月30日北美首映。

终极一班 第三部 哪里更新最快啊?---hDf0

已经有啦,刚看呢,给力啊--KiHf3

我可以创建一个抽象类来与第三部分类一起使用吗?(Can I create an abstract class to use with a 3rd part classes?)

你可以创建自己的继承者: public abstract class BaseMyThirdParty<T> where T : class { public T OriginalObject { get; set; } public BaseMyThirdParty(T originalObject) { this.OriginalObject = originalObject; } public virtual T LoadObject(stri ...

第三部分可以是什么 - >链接序列?(What can the third section be in -> chaining sequence?)

方法可以返回一个对象。 您可以将此对象分配给变量,然后在其上调用方法: $objB = $objA->getObjectB(); $objB->someMethod(); 或者你可以跳过作业并将其内联; $objA->getObjectB()->someMethod(); 只要您的方法返回对象,您就可以继续堆叠它们: $objA->getObjectB()->getObjectC()->getObjectD()->getObjectE(); 对象属性也是如此。 公共财产可以容纳另一个对象: ...

列表第三部分的第一个索引号(The first index number of the third part of the list)

如果你说这三部分一直存在,我们可以通过将True和False值转换为int来使用np.diff()和argmax() 。 def gfi_third(x): return (np.diff(x.astype(int)) > 0).argmax() + 1 样品运行: three_parts_list = np.array([True, False, False, False, False, False,True, True]) three_parts_list2 = np.array( ...

Dagger 2第三部分Android注入(Dagger 2 Third part Injection Android)

通常在Application实例中实例化Dagger组件。 由于您可能没有从Application类引用WearService ,因此您需要让WearService要求您的Application提供Bus 。 您可以通过两种方式执行此操作: 通过向EventBus组件添加inject(WearService wearService)方法: @Component(modules = EventBusModule.class) @Singleton public interface EventBus ...

使用boost spirit语法(boost 1.43和g ++ 4.4.1)第三部分构建错误(build error with boost spirit grammar (boost 1.43 and g++ 4.4.1) part III)

使用phoenix :: push_back的第二种形式是建议的形式。 问题在于定义了语义动作。 -(whatever % ",")构造的属性值类型为vector<whatever> ,然后将其作为vector<MockExpressionNode>上调用的push_back参数传递。 换句话说,精神不是切换参数,代码本质上是vector<>.push_back(vector<>) 。 您可以在发布的最后一个错误块的第三行中看到此信息: /home/.../container.hpp:492: e ...